<em><a href="http://dragoneternity.com/">Dragon Eternity</a></em> has always been a pretty neat browser-based game that drew me in more with its mechanics and UI design than with its actual gameplay. Frankly, the game is a grind. You'll be sent on quest after quest that is basically kill-ten-whatever, with the occasional gather quest thrown in for good measure. I wasn't terribly thrilled with it before, but I did find myself occasionally enjoying it. The artwork in the game is beautiful. That alone is a reason to poke my head into the title once in a while.<br />
<br />
Now that a new iPad version has been released, I just had to give it another go to see if it felt the same as before. I have to say, how you interface with a game can <em>really</em> make a difference. Sure, the grind is still there, and the quests are generally the same at higher levels as they are at level one, but the iPad works awesome.<br />
<br />
That's not all, however. First released in Russia in April 2011, <em><a href="http://massively.joystiq.com/tag/dragon-eternity/">Dragon Eternity</a></em> was later localized in English and grew to include players in other countries. Now, the browser-based fantasy game is expanding into another frontier -- mobile devices. In this exclusive video diary, developers announced that the game is being developed as a cross-platform experience; <em>Dragon Eternity</em> will release for the iPad this spring, then Android and Facebook versions will soon follow.<br />
<br />
The video also discussed different aspects of the game, such as the newly implemented naval battles and the quests' tie-ins to minigames. Upcoming content in the works includes player battlegrounds and private castles where players can give others quests to each other. Check out all the details in the video after the cut.<br />

I have a fondness for <a href="http://warofdragons.com/"><em>War of Dragons</em></a>, a sort of two-dimensional action-based MMO from <a href="http://corp.mail.ru/de-en">Mail.Ru</a>. When <a href="http://massively.joystiq.com/2011/11/11/mmobility-the-clever-design-behind-war-of-dragons/">I looked at the game before</a>, I enjoyed the design elements and artwork more than anything, but the grindy nature of the game basically turned me off. Still, there's something cool about a semi-graphical MMO that runs in a browser. So when I took a second, deeper look at <a href="http://dragoneternity.com/"><em>Dragon Eternity</em></a>, an MMO that resembles <a href="http://massively.joystiq.com/tag/war-of-dragons/"><em>War of Dragons</em></a> in many ways, I expected about the same outcome.<br />
<br />
I came out of this week with a bit more of an appreciation for both games mainly because I was able to see <a href="http://massively.joystiq.com/tag/dragon-eternity/"><em>Dragon Eternity</em></a> as what it is: a simple game that can become more complex with time.
